Position Overview:
Navistar has a great opportunity for an Sr. Executive Assistant to support the Executive Vice President (EVP) of Commercial Operations and the EVP of Service Solutions, reporting to the EVP of Service Solutions.
The individual will be responsible for performing a wide array of administrative functions requiring confidentiality, initiative and sound decision making along with a high level of professionalism.
The successful candidate is someone who can address problems independently and apply both strategic and execution-oriented thinking while anticipating executive needs in a fast-paced environment, sometimes under pressure, while remaining flexible, proactive, resourceful, and efficient.
This position will be based at our corporate headquarters in Lisle, Illinois.
Responsibilities:
Protect Navistar’s reputation by keeping information confidential.
Maintain professional and technical knowledge by attending educational workshops, reading professional publications, establishing personal networks, and participating in professional societies.
Structures, organizes, and expedites the activities and workflow of the supported executives.
Prioritize schedules, develops, and initiates a system of follow-up for projects, meetings, and issues to assure the efficient and effective management of the supported executives.
Maintain and manage executive calendar and some email inboxes
Schedule meetings and resolve conflicts
Coordinate travel arrangements
Organize and may attend executive staff meetings, take meeting minutes, and distribute action items to attendees
Plan and support organizational events and logistics
Assist with arrangements for visitors to our Lisle headquarters
Coordinate IT issue resolution
Complete and manage expense reports and submit them in a timely manner with complete accuracy
Quickly identify critical issues and navigate priorities based on last minute changes
Assist and coordinate special projects
Manage multiple priorities simultaneously with attention to detail and accuracy, and reprioritize as needed
Manage third party requisitions
Works with the EVP’s direct reports to gather any information needed by the executive and compiles information for review
Supports the direct reports to the EVP as needed
Minimum Requirements:
Bachelor’s degree and at least 2 years of executive administrative experience
OR
Master’s degree and no experience
OR
At least 4 years of executive administrative experience

Company Overview:
Navistar, Inc. (“Navistar”) is a purpose-driven company, reimagining how to deliver what matters to create more cohesive relationships, build higher-performing teams and find solutions where others don’t.
Based in Lisle, Illinois, Navistar or its subsidiaries and affiliates produce International® brand commercial trucks and engines, IC Bus® brand school and commercial buses, all-makes OnCommand® Connection advanced connectivity services, and Fleetrite®, ReNEWeD® and Diamond Advantage® brand aftermarket parts.
With a history of innovation dating back to 1831, Navistar has more than 14,500 employees worldwide and is part of TRATON SE, a global champion of the truck and transport services industry. Additional information is available at .
